Common Causes of your Concrete Problems in Ashland City

Noticing your floors becoming uneven or walls developing cracks? Homes in this area often face such issues due to the unique environmental conditions affecting the ground beneath them. In Ashland City, moisture levels can fluctuate significantly, causing the soil to expand and contract. Clay-heavy soils in particular absorb water and swell, while drying leads to shrinking and settling. Such cyclical changes in soil volume put pressure on your home's foundation. Local rainfall patterns accentuate these effects, as homes may deal with seasonal moisture surges followed by periods of drying out. These natural cycles can destabilize the ground and affect the structural integrity of many houses.

As these conditions persist, foundations, basements, and crawl spaces often bear the brunt of the resulting stress. Cracks in walls, uneven flooring, sticking doors, and even water pooling in basements can be signals of underlying foundation issues. If not addressed promptly, these small problems can evolve into significant structural concerns. Concrete lifting can be a valuable solution by helping to realign and stabilize the affected areas, reducing further damage. Early detection of these warning signs allows homeowners to mitigate bigger risks, maintaining the safety and value of homes in this region.

Yes, addressing uneven concrete with slab leveling techniques like foam injection can be budget-friendly. These methods utilize expanding foam to lift sunken slabs effectively, minimizing labor and material costs. Foam injection not only stabilizes the base but also fills voids caused by soil erosion. Tackling such issues early can prevent more costly future repairs. Consider consulting a professional to explore the most efficient options for your situation.

No, adding more concrete on top of sunken areas is not advisable as it may not address the underlying causes. This approach could lead to further settling or cracking, especially if soil erosion or expansion remains unaddressed. Slab leveling techniques such as foam injection are preferred to lift and stabilize the sunken slab effectively. Opting for these methods ensures a long-lasting solution and prevents additional issues.

Yes, uneven concrete slabs pose trip hazards that can lead to injuries. Aside from safety concerns, sunken slabs may indicate underlying soil erosion or voids that could worsen over time. Slab leveling and polyurethane foam injection can correct these issues by filling voids and stabilizing the base. Address potential hazards promptly to ensure safety and preserve property value.

Ashland City's clay-rich soil can expand and contract with moisture changes, contributing to concrete cracks and sinking. Seasonal weather variations exacerbate these conditions, leading to soil erosion and settlements. Slab leveling and foam injection can offset these effects by stabilizing the soil and lifting sunken concrete. Regular inspections and timely repairs are essential to maintain structural integrity.

Lifting processes like foam injection can prevent future sinking by stabilizing the soil and addressing voids under settled concrete. These methods provide a leveled slab that resists further soil movement or expansion, reducing the risk of future cracks. Regular maintenance and monitoring of soil conditions can help sustain these repairs. Consult a specialist to ensure lasting effectiveness.
